Transaction 63604ea94a6cdc022f943ca60be79218fbb58f2ac4ba04858055729af6c7f531
1 Input
1 Output
-
63604ea94a6cdc022f943ca60be79218fbb58f2ac4ba04858055729af6c7f531:0
- value
- 93555244
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dacb16722d252145ab95a618a98d113ede0186f1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lwsbbi14wceskbQr7PFVtqeBwcdRFLj8T